Effects of Drawn Strain and Aging Temperature on Critical Diffusible Hydrogen Content and Absorbed Hydrogen Content in Pearlitic Steel Wires

Abstract: Itiswell-knownthatpearliticsteelwireshaveahigherresistancetohydrogenembrittlementthantemperedmartensiticsteels.Itissignificant to clarify the effect of various mechanisms of the hardening on hydrogen embrittlement for the compatibility between high strength and resistance to hydrogen embrittlement. In this study, effects of drawing strain and aging temperature in pearlitic steel wires on hydrogen embrittlement properties were investigated.
